Transaction

d3ea2f058ab6991d8f161a3c83f538ae031335ee8a87981967ed4ff4e5a514ca
93,520 confirmations
Timestamp
1717120646
Block845,845
Fee2,640 sats
Fee rate23.4 sats/vB
view on mempool.space

Inputs & Outputs